Which States Have The Most Competitive Tax Codes? We've just released the 12th annual edition of the *State Business Tax Climate Index <http://TaxFoundation.us1.list-manage2.com/track/click?u=fefb55dc846b4d629857464f8&id=f6acd3da82&e=e8dfe8119a>*, which measures how competitive and well-structured each state’s tax code is by analyzing over 100 tax variables in five different categories: corporate, individual income, sales, property, and unemployment insurance taxes. Wyoming once again takes first place with the best tax code in the country, while New Jersey continues its hold on last place. States are punished for overly complex, burdensome, and economically harmful tax codes, and are rewarded for transparent and neutral tax codes that do not distort business decisions. A state’s ranking can rise or fall significantly based not just on its own actions, but also on the changes or reforms made by other states. *This year’s most competitive states include: * Wyoming (#1), South Dakota (#2), Alaska (#3), Florida (#4), Nevada (#5), Montana (#6), New Hampshire (#7), Indiana (#8), Utah (#9) and Texas (#10). *This year’s least competitive states include: * New Jersey (#50) New York (#49), California (#48), Minnesota (#47), Vermont (#46), Rhode Island (#45), Connecticut (#44), Wisconsin (#43), Ohio (#42), and Maryland (#41).
